User Experience at the Top Online Casinos That Accept Echeck
User Experience at the Top Online Casinos That Accept Echeck When it comes to your enjoyment and satisfaction at online casinos, user experience is crucial. Understanding how to navigate platforms that accept e-check payments can significantly enhance your gaming experience. The best online casinos not only offer an extensive variety of games but also provide […]
